2021 (SENIOR): Played in eight matches, starting in three...Scored two goals and handed out two assists..Scored one goal and tallied one assist at Clayton State (Sept. 18)...PBC Presidential Honor Roll Silver Scholar...D2 ADA award recipient.
2020 (SENIOR): Played in all 10 matches with nine starts...Scored two goals and tallied one assist...Scored a goal and registered an assist at Georgia Southwestern (Apr. 2)...Scored Flagler's lone goal in the PBC Tournament final vs. Columbus State (Apr. 10)...Earned academic all-conference honors...Earned PBC Presidential Honor Roll Silver Scholar honors...D2 ADA award recipient.
2019 (JUNIOR): Played in 25 matches with 24 starts...Scored five goals and tallied three assists...Converted on all four penalty kick attempts...Scored the golden goal vs. Clayton State in the PBC final (Nov. 17)...Earned academic all-conference honors.
2018 (SOPHOMORE): Played in 12 matches with four starts...Scored two goals...Scored a goal vs. Georgia Southwestern (Oct. 9) and at Palm Beach Atlantic (Oct. 17)...Played a season-high 86 minutes in the season opener at Florida Southern (Aug. 30)...PBC Presidential Honor Roll Gold Scholar...D2 ADA award recipient.
BEFORE FLAGLER: Attended Louisiana Tech University in Ruston, La.
2017 (FRESHMAN): Appeared in 11 matches, including two starts...First career action came in second game of the season at Texas State (Aug. 20), played 12 minutes...Took one shot on the season which resulted in a goal at Mississippi Valley State (Aug. 27) on a converted penalty kick...Played a season-high 60 minutes against the Devilettes...Also made a start versus LSU-Alexandria (Sept. 15), playing 45 minutes...Saw action off the bench in four Conference-USA matches.
PREP SCHOOL: Graduated with high honors from IMG Academy in Bradenton, Florida...Lettered in soccer for two seasons...She received the U20 MVP award as a senior...Earned the Player of the Year award and was a Student-Athlete of the Month in 2016-17...As a junior, she helped lead the team to a State Cup title...Won the Defensive Player of the Year award...Received the U17 MVP award...Member of the National Honor Society.
CLUB: Helped lead team to the CONADEIP national championships (ITESM Puebla) where it finished in second place (2015) and third place (2014)...Was a member of the Mexican U17 National Team that competed in the Women's Cup in Costa Rica (2013)...Helped lead Leon to the Mexican national championship in 2013.
PERSONAL: Daughter of Francisco Lopez and Graciela Miranda...Has a brother and sister...An economics major.
